Licensed under the MIT license. // See LICENSE in the project root for license information. import { DocNodeKind, DocNode } from './DocNode'; import { DocExcerpt, ExcerptKind } from './DocExcerpt'; /** * Represents a span of comment text that is considered by the parser * to contain no special symbols or meaning. * * @remarks * The text content must not contain newline characters. * Use DocSoftBreak to represent manual line splitting. */ export class DocPlainText extends DocNode { /** * Don't call this directly. Instead use {@link TSDocParser} * @internal */ constructor(parameters) { super(parameters); if (DocNode.isParsedParameters(parameters)) { this._textExcerpt = new DocExcerpt({ configuration: this.configuration, excerptKind: ExcerptKind.PlainText, content: parameters.textExcerpt }); } else { if (DocPlainText._newlineCharacterRegExp.test(parameters.text)) { // Use DocSoftBreak to represent manual line splitting throw new Error('The DocPlainText content must not contain newline characters'); } this._text = parameters.text; } } /** @override */ get kind() { return DocNodeKind.PlainText; } /** * The text content. */ get text() { if (this._text === undefined) { this._text = this._textExcerpt.content.toString(); } return this._text; } get textExcerpt() { if (this._textExcerpt) { return this._textExcerpt.content; } else { return undefined; } } /** @override */ onGetChildNodes() { return [this._textExcerpt]; } } // TODO: We should also prohibit "\r", but this requires updating LineExtractor // to interpret a lone "\r" as a newline DocPlainText._newlineCharacterRegExp = /[\n]/; //# sourceMappingURL=DocPlainText.js.map
